Java棋牌游戏开发技术解析java棋牌游戏需要什么技术

已经很详细,涵盖了需求分析、具体步骤和挑战与解决方案,我需要确保文章结构清晰,涵盖全面,同时补充更多细节,使其更具实用价值。 我需要考虑用户可能没有明确提到的需求,跨平台开发、优化性能、处理复杂游戏逻辑等都是在开发过程中常见的挑战,用户可能对Java的特性,如面向对象编程和多线程,感兴趣,因此可以深入探讨这些特性在游戏开发中的应用。 关于数据库设计,用户可能对关系型数据库和NoSQL数据库的比较感兴趣,以及如何优化查询性能,用户可能希望获得实际的开发建议,如选择合适的框架、测试和部署方法。 我还需要确保文章结构清晰,从需求分析到部署的整个流程,深入讨论每个技术点,并提供实际应用中的建议,这样,用户不仅能了解需要哪些技术,还能获得如何有效应用这些技术的指导。 我需要确保语言简洁明了,避免使用过于专业的术语,同时保持技术的准确性,通过这样的思考,我可以写出一篇既全面又有深度的文章,满足用户的需求。

开发一个Java棋牌游戏需要综合运用多种技术,包括游戏规则的实现、多线程技术、数据库设计、网络通信、图形界面设计等,通过系统的分析和设计,结合Java的特性,开发者可以开发出一个功能完善、运行稳定的棋牌游戏,随着技术的不断进步,Java将继续在棋牌游戏开发中发挥重要作用。

发表评论